The Mudd Club N-706-7060Condition: BRAND NEW ISBN: 9781627310512 Format: Trade paperback (US) Year: 2017 Publisher: Feral House Description: "I was a Long Island kid that graduated college in 1976 and moved to Greenwich Village. Two years later, I was working The Mudd Club door. Standing outside, staring at the crowd, it was "out there" versus "in here" and I was on the inside.
